Output 61d2bea8f5a46fa6d923d28fd25102caa788ab67f7e1ee99c7981d3892abaa7f:3

value
324868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af2008af35ddfdca69d7168f174db31649dd7ab OP_EQUAL
address
3Cu6GYoctbH7b5Xpp2MochQ3oDZVfc59MW
transaction
61d2bea8f5a46fa6d923d28fd25102caa788ab67f7e1ee99c7981d3892abaa7f
spent
true